Resident urges Ventnor to ban gas‑powered backpack blowers; city attorney to draft ordinance
Summary
A Ventnor Green Team representative urged the commission to ban gas-powered backpack leaf blowers because of noise and air pollution; commissioners signaled support for education and instructed the city attorney to begin drafting an ordinance for future consideration.
During public comment Diane Birkbeck, speaking for the Ventnor Green Team, asked the commission to begin a process to ban gas‑powered backpack blowers and replace them with electric/battery alternatives.
